For more * information on the Apache Software Foundation, please see * <http://www.apache.org/>. * */ package org.apache.wicket.util.diff; import java.util.ArrayList; import java.util.Arrays; import java.util.LinkedList; import java.util.List; import java.util.ListIterator; /** * A Revision holds the series of deltas that describe the differences between two sequences. * * @version $Revision: 1.1 $ $Date: 2006/03/12 00:24:21 $ * * @author <a href="mailto:juanco@suigeneris.org">Juanco Anez</a> * @author <a href="mailto:bwm@hplb.hpl.hp.com">Brian McBride</a> * * @see Delta * @see Diff * @see Chunk * @see Revision modifications 27 Apr 2003 bwm * * Added visitor pattern Visitor interface and accept() method. */ public class Revision extends ToString { List<Delta> deltas_ = new LinkedList<>(); /** * Creates an empty Revision. */ public Revision() { } /** * Adds a delta to this revision. * * @param delta * the {@link Delta Delta} to add. */ public synchronized void addDelta(final Delta delta) { if (delta == null) { throw new IllegalArgumentException("new delta is null"); } deltas_.add(delta); } /** * Adds a delta to the start of this revision. * * @param delta * the {@link Delta Delta} to add. */ public synchronized void insertDelta(final Delta delta) { if (delta == null) { throw new IllegalArgumentException("new delta is null"); } deltas_.add(0, delta); } /** * Retrieves a delta from this revision by position. * * @param i * the position of the delta to retrieve. * @return the specified delta */ public Delta getDelta(final int i) { return deltas_.get(i); } /** * Returns the number of deltas in this revision. * * @return the number of deltas. */ public int size() { return deltas_.size(); } /** * Applies the series of deltas in this revision as patches to the given text. * * @param src * the text to patch, which the method doesn't change. * @return the resulting text after the patches have been applied. * @throws PatchFailedException * if any of the patches cannot be applied. */ public Object[] patch(final Object[] src) throws PatchFailedException { List<Object> target = new ArrayList<>(Arrays.asList(src)); applyTo(target); return target.toArray(); } /** * Applies the series of deltas in this revision as patches to the given text. * * @param target * the text to patch. * @throws PatchFailedException * if any of the patches cannot be applied. */ public synchronized void applyTo(final List<Object> target) throws PatchFailedException { ListIterator<Delta> i = deltas_.listIterator(deltas_.size()); while (i.hasPrevious()) { Delta delta = i.previous(); delta.patch(target); } } /** * Converts this revision into its Unix diff style string representation. * * @param s * a {@link StringBuilder StringBuffer} to which the string representation will be * appended. */ @Override public synchronized void toString(final StringBuilder s) { for (Delta delta : deltas_) { delta.toString(s); } } /** * Converts this revision into its RCS style string representation. * * @param s * a {@link StringBuilder StringBuffer} to which the string representation will be * appended. * @param EOL * the string to use as line separator. */ public synchronized void toRCSString(final StringBuilder s, final String EOL) { for (Delta deltas : deltas_) { deltas.toRCSString(s, EOL); } } /** * Converts this revision into its RCS style string representation. * * @param s * a {@link StringBuilder StringBuffer} to which the string representation will be * appended. */ public void toRCSString(final StringBuilder s) { toRCSString(s, Diff.NL); } /** * Converts this delta into its RCS style string representation. * * @param EOL * the string to use as line separator. * @return String */ public String toRCSString(final String EOL) { StringBuilder s = new StringBuilder(); toRCSString(s, EOL); return s.toString(); } /** * Converts this delta into its RCS style string representation using the default line * separator. * * @return String */ public String toRCSString() { return toRCSString(Diff.NL); } /** * Accepts a visitor. * * @param visitor * the {@link RevisionVisitor} visiting this instance */ public void accept(final RevisionVisitor visitor) { visitor.visit(this); for (Delta delta : deltas_) { delta.accept(visitor); } } }
